草庐IT

mySQL SELECT 多个

全部标签

php - 具有多个值的 Laravel 流畅插入仅插入第一个值

我正在尝试运行单个播种器类:insert(['name'=>'PhD'],['name'=>'Master'],['name'=>'Bachelor'],['name'=>'Foundation'],['name'=>'ESL']);}}我执行命令:artdb:seed--classCourseTableSeeder我希望在数据库中看到这五个值,但是,我只看到第一个“phd”。我尝试通过在插入上运行->toSql()来调试它,但我认为这是不可能的,我收到以下错误,因为插入很可能返回bool值,因此不可链接[2018-07-2315:35:45]local.ERROR:Calltoame

php - preg_match 从字符串返回多个值

我想从一些URL中提取两个值。示例网址:cricket-ck-game-playhand-ball-hb-game-playvolley-ball-vb-game-playsoccer-sc-game-play我想分别提取完整游戏名称及其短名称,忽略URL末尾的-game-play部分。我尝试了以下代码,它返回“ck”、“hb”、“vb”、“sc”,但不返回全名。preg_match("/(?我得到的实际结果:array(1){[0]=>string(2)"ck"}预期结果:case:1(Incaseofexample1)-array(2){[0]=>string(7)"cricket

php - 在 CodeIgniter session 中存储多个具有相同名称的输入

我已经发布了这个intheCodeIgniterforum并且还耗尽了论坛搜索引擎,如果交叉发布不受欢迎,我们深表歉意。基本上,我有一个输入,设置为.根据用户的请求,他们可以添加另一个目标,这会向DOM抛出一个副本。我需要做的是在我的CodeIgniterController中获取这些值并将它们存储在session变量中。我的Controller目前是这样构造的:functiongoalsAdd(){$meeting_title=$this->input->post('topic');$meeting_hours=$this->input->post('hours');$meeting

php CURL - 多个独立 session - 需要帮助!

这是我的困境...我基本上有一个脚本,它通过CURL发布到第3方网站以执行登录,然后发布另一个帖子以根据该登录session更新用户详细信息。现在,随着我的网站越来越忙,我有多个用户在做同样的事情,似乎curl有时会变得困惑,并用不同的用户信息更新一个用户的详细信息。这导致了真正的问题。似乎是用户在一次登录后使用的cookie被其他用户共享,他们最终使用相同的cookie登录-混淆了第3方系统。我的代码发布在下面,我需要使用cookiefile和cookiejar来维护phpsession以允许我做我需要做的事情。但似乎所有用户都在重复使用同一个cookie……那有意义吗?有什么我可以

php - 将内容设置为多个 TinyMCE 文本区域?

我的页面中有3个tinymcetextarea。我想从ajax填充这些文本区域。我知道原始textarea字段的名称,但是tinyMCE.activeEditor.setContent(value);不起作用,因为我没有任何事件的编辑器。这是我的代码的一个基本示例...function(data){$.each(data,function(key,value)){$("#"+key).val(value);//"#"+keyistheidoftinymceeditorsinmyform},"json".... 最佳答案 试试这个fo

php - PHP 中的多个正则表达式

有没有更好的方法来处理在PHP中(或一般情况下)运行多个正则表达式?我有下面的代码用破折号替换非字母数字字符,一旦替换发生,我想删除多个破折号的实例。$slug=preg_replace('/[^A-Za-z0-9]/i','-',$slug);$slug=preg_replace('/\-{2,}/i','-',$slug);有没有更简洁的方法来做到这一点?即,设置正则表达式模式以替换一个模式,然后替换另一个模式?(说到正则表达式,我就像一个插在socket里的child) 最佳答案 你可以通过说出你在第一个中的真正意思来消除第二

php - 如何使用 "onchange="向 PHP 发送多个值?

我有两个单选按钮类别:color1和color2。颜色1可以是黑色或白色,颜色2可以是红色或蓝色。我只希望用户能够从一个类别或两个类别中进行选择,然后用PHP回应这些选择。我的问题是它不会同时回显两个类别的选择。例如,如果我点击“白色”单选按钮,然后点击“蓝色”单选按钮,它只会回显“蓝色”,而不是“白色”和“蓝色”。更新:selectfirstcolor:blackwhiteselectsecondcolor:redblue 最佳答案 您需要在执行请求时将这两个变量发送到(正如在yes123的回答中所示)。或者您可以在PHP中使用$

php - 如何使用 AJAX 和 PHP 返回多个项目

是否可以通过AJAX和PHP返回多个项目?我正在阅读它,它看起来就像PHP中的echo和通过Javascript的responseText。我可以通过PHP返回一组项目并将其转换为Javascript或HTML吗? 最佳答案 这取决于您的PHP响应发送的数据格式-听起来您看到的示例只是纯文本。在我看来,最好的格式是JSON,它可以发送一个包含多个结果的数组,甚至是一个多层次的多维数组。参见json_encode()在PHP和JSONexamplesonjquery.com. 关于php-

php - 是否可以在 PDOStatement 对象的单个实例上执行多个 fetch() 操作?

例子:$query=$mydb->query('PRAGMAtable_info("mytable")');//variablequeryhasnowtypeofPDOStatementObjectprint_r($query->fetchAll(PDO::FETCH_COLUMN,1));//thisresultisokprint_r($query->fetchAll(PDO::FETCH_COLUMN,2));//butthisresultgivesemptyarray那么有什么方法可以重用语句对象吗? 最佳答案 当没有更多行可

php - 检查数组中是否有多个值

我想检查数字7、86和99是否存在于名为$category的数组中。到目前为止我已经有了这个,但我不想用三行来完成它:if(in_array("7",$category)){//dosomething} 最佳答案 $search=array("7","86","99");如果id是$category变量的键:if(count(array_intersect($search,array_keys($category)))==count($search)){//allfound}if(count(array_intersect($sea